Description

Fair-Way Properties are pleased to present a 3 bedroom semi-detached property located on the sought-after gates estate in Birstall. The property has excellent development potential with the option to extend to the side (subject to planning permission). Downstairs the property briefly comprises of an open porch, a hallway, and a living room which leads to the kitchen / diner. Upstairs there are two double bedrooms, a single bedroom, and a bathroom with a shower above the bath. To the front of the property there is a driveway providing off road parking for 1 car in front of the garage with the potential for additional parking in front of the house. To the side of the property there is a freestanding brick garage with a small workshop and store at the end. To the rear of the property there is a mature garden with a lawn area and a variety of plants, shrubs, bushes, and trees. The property benefits from gas central heating including a combination boiler and is partially double glazed.
